Le Grand, California had a population of 1,592 in 2020. It was 13.4% White, 0.7% Black, 0.3% Asian, 83.5% Hispanic, 0.4% Native American/Other, and 1.7% Multiracial. This map presents the population of Le Grand, with one dot drawn for each person counted in the 2020 Census, color-coded by race.

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is the 959th most populous. This ranking is based on the Census definition of a place, which includes incorporated places like cities, towns, and villages, as well as unincorporated census-designated places (CDPs).

Le Grand's White Population

213 residents of Le Grand identify as White, or 13.4%. This makes the White share of the population of Le Grand considerably less than the White share of the population of California (34.7% White).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is ranked #1391 in terms of White residents as a share of the population.

Le Grand is more White than neighboring Planada (4.1% White). Le Grand is less White than neighboring Chowchilla (35.6% White), Tuttle (25.5% White), Fairmead (16.9% White), and Bear Creek (14.3% White).

Le Grand's Black Population

11 residents of Le Grand identify as Black, or 0.7%. This makes the Black share of the population of Le Grand roughly similar to the Black share of the population of California (5.4% Black).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is ranked #875 in terms of Black residents as a share of the population.

Le Grand is less Black than neighboring Planada (1.2% Black), Chowchilla (9.5% Black), Tuttle (3.9% Black), Fairmead (5.8% Black), and Bear Creek (2.6% Black).

Le Grand's Asian Population

4 residents of Le Grand identify as Asian, or 0.3%. This makes the Asian share of the population of Le Grand less than the Asian share of the population of California (15.1% Asian).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is ranked #1369 in terms of Asian residents as a share of the population.

Le Grand is less Asian than neighboring Planada (0.6% Asian), Chowchilla (2.6% Asian), Tuttle (5.9% Asian), Fairmead (0.6% Asian), and Bear Creek (4.4% Asian).

Le Grand's Hispanic Population

1,330 residents of Le Grand identify as Hispanic, or 83.5%. This makes the Hispanic share of the population of Le Grand considerably larger than the Hispanic share of the population of California (39.4% Hispanic).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is ranked #127 in terms of Hispanic residents as a share of the population.

Le Grand is more Hispanic than neighboring Chowchilla (47.6% Hispanic), Tuttle (52.9% Hispanic), Fairmead (70.9% Hispanic), and Bear Creek (71.4% Hispanic). Le Grand is less Hispanic than neighboring Planada (92.7% Hispanic).

Le Grand's Native American/Other Population

7 residents of Le Grand identify as American Indian/Alaska Native/Native Hawaiian/Pacific Islander/Other, or 0.4%. This makes the Native American/Other share of the population of Le Grand roughly similar to the Native American/Other share of the population of California (1.3% Native American/Other).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is ranked #1443 in terms of Native American/Other residents as a share of the population.

Le Grand is less Native American/Other than neighboring Planada (0.7% Native American/Other), Chowchilla (1.6% Native American/Other), Tuttle (2.9% Native American/Other), Fairmead (1.6% Native American/Other), and Bear Creek (3.3% Native American/Other).

Le Grand's Multiracial Population

27 residents of Le Grand identify as Multiracial, or 1.7%. This makes the Multiracial share of the population of Le Grand roughly similar to the Multiracial share of the population of California (4.1% Multiracial). Of the 1,611 places in California, Le Grand is ranked #1365 in terms of Multiracial residents as a share of the population.

Le Grand is more Multiracial than neighboring Planada (0.8% Multiracial). Le Grand is less Multiracial than neighboring Chowchilla (3.2% Multiracial), Tuttle (8.8% Multiracial), Fairmead (4.2% Multiracial), and Bear Creek (4% Multiracial).
